Porsche Builds 200,000th Cayenne

Date February 3, 2008

A red Cayenne GTS was the 200,000th pepper to roll off the assembly line since launching in 2002. The Cayenne is Porsche’s best selling vehicle, and has helped them reign as the world’s most profitable auto maker. Not surprisingly, the U.S. is the Cayenne’s biggest market, accounting for 30% of all Cayenne sales. Congrats! [source: [...]

How Much Is That GTS in the Window?

Date January 30, 2008

Porsche has announced pricing and availability for the new Cayenne GTS. The new pepper will go on sale in February and is priced at $69,300. The GTS features a 405 hp 4.8 L V8, 21-inch wheels, standard air suspension with PASM, a lowered stance, exclusive interior features, and the availability of a 6-speed manual gearbox. [...]

Rinspeed “X-treme” Cayenne

Date January 11, 2008

Rinspeed is the latest tuner to launch a pumped-up Cayenne. Check out the Rinspeed “X-treme”. The X-treme features probably the most tasteful, yet still agressive, body kit I’ve seen on a tuner Cayenne. It features an aggressive front end, wheel flares and side skirts, huge 23 inch wheels, air outlets on the hood, and more. [...]
